Output de5b9060b00afa70fc2df4cd4d0502dcc8cedc9ef42578e5cf0a0998b60d2666:30

value
39162866
script pubkey
OP_0 OP_PUSHBYTES_32 1dd4dfb93f46707945bb01e5e2677b5048ab0c4805cf8465e365af53c6ee4d36
address
bc1qrh2dlwflgec8j3dmq8j7yemm2py2krzgqh8cge0rvkh483hwf5mq4vf6gu
transaction
de5b9060b00afa70fc2df4cd4d0502dcc8cedc9ef42578e5cf0a0998b60d2666
spent
true